The Importance of Behavioral Health Billing Services

Behavioral health billing involves a unique set of requirements that distinguish it from general medical billing. Due to time-based sessions, recurring appointments, and specialized documentation needs, mental health practices benefit from dedicated Behavioral Health Billing Services.

Managing Unique Mental Health Billing Challenges

Common challenges faced by behavioral health practices include:

Accurate coding for therapy and psychiatric sessions

Proper documentation of time-based sessions

Prior authorization requirements

Tele-mental health compliance

Handling recurring appointments

Billing teams with experience in mental health understand these complexities and ensure that claims are submitted accurately, reducing denials and delays.

The Role of Medical Billing and Coding in Mental Health

Accurate Medical Billing and Coding is critical for proper reimbursement. Coding errors can result in denials, delayed payments, or audits, which may negatively impact revenue.

Experts help by:

Correctly assigning CPT and ICD codes

Aligning diagnosis codes with treatment sessions

Applying modifiers for telehealth and add-on services

Ensuring compliance with payer documentation rules

Proper coding not only ensures timely reimbursement but also strengthens overall revenue integrity.
